A. to improve speech -read different books to the child -talk to the child daily routine like the child understands you with regular eye contact -singing songs and rhymes -while talking repeat what your child says with right pronunciation and do not critidcize the child -avoid screen time(tv mobile laptop). leave permit the child to watch the activities that allow to improve his language -take your dchild outside (open environment) and have a talk with the child regarding the things around the child -introduce new words gradually for proper understanding -speak about things child is interested in.

Regarding Speech Baby usually start mono syllable by 6 to 7 months of age then by syllable words come by 9 to 10 months of age then by 12 to 14 months of age baby say two to three words followed by jargon speech at 15-16 months . child cyan start saying simple sentences by two years of age . just make the child comfortable and do more interaction with the chilbid so that he can learn to speak sentences properly. if the speech does not comes even by three years of age you need to consult your doctor for a proper assessment of the child .
